## Configuration

Tarnlow reloads config on file change — no restarts. Edit `.env`, save, and watchers pick it up within two seconds. Only non-secret keys hot-reload; secrets require a process restart for safety. Copy `.env.example` to `.env` before first run. The reload watcher itself authenticates to the config bus, so your env file needs:

env line for fafof-fahag: LEDGER_TOKEN5=f8790

**Ticket: Config drift on BounceSift processor**

The email bounce processor in the Larkfield environment has drifted from the values committed in the release branch. Retry windows and suppression thresholds no longer match, which likely explains the duplicate suppression entries reported Tuesday. Please reconcile before the Thursday cut. For reference, the currently deployed configuration on the live node reads as follows.

config for yajep-yahof:
[briax]
port = 9200
region = outer-2
host = briax.nelvrocorp.test
team = raleth
timeout_ms = 1500
retries = 1

## Releases

TranscodeBarn ships weekly. Cut from main, run the codec conformance suite, and verify worker autoscaling configs against the Larkfield cluster. Failed jobs older than 24h must be drained first. Tag the release, build the farm image, and push. Sign the image with the deploy key below:

rollout seal: bky4_x7Gc